WECAM5MPA Wi-Fi+Ethernet C-Mount-Kamera

Product Introduction

WECAM5MPA is a high-performance Wi-Fi+Ethernet C-Mount-Kamera featuring Sony IMX178(C) sensor, with resolution up to 5MP (2592×1944), supporting LAN, Wi-Fi 802.11ac multiple output methods.

Model: WECAM5MPA
Sensor: Sony IMX178(C)
Resolution: 5MP (2592×1944)
Sensor Size: 1/1.8" (6.22×4.67mm)
Pixel Size: 2.4μm × 2.4μm
Frame Rate: LAN/Wi-Fi: 30fps@2592×1944
Output Interface: LAN, Wi-Fi 802.11ac
Lens Mount: C-Mount-Anschluss

WECAM5MPA Specifications

General Parameters
Product ModelWECAM5MPA
Product SeriesWi-Fi+Ethernet C-Mount-Kamera
SensorSony IMX178(C)
Imaging Performance
Resolution5MP (2592×1944)
Pixel Size2.4μm × 2.4μm
Frame RateLAN/Wi-Fi: 30fps@2592×1944
Shutter TypeRolling Shutter
Network & Control
Output InterfacesLAN, Wi-Fi 802.11ac
Network ModesAP / STA
Software SupportToupView, ToupLite
Physical & Environmental
Dimensions78 × 65 × 98.3 mm
Weight0.19 kg
Operating Temperature-10°C ~ +50°C
Power SupplyDC 12V/1A
Operating SystemWindows, Linux, macOS
CertificationCE, FCC, RoHS

WECAM Wi-Fi + Ethernet Camera | Packing List #

Standard Items in the Box

  • A Camera box: 25.5 cm × 17.0 cm × 9.0 cm (1 pc, approx. 1.57 kg per box)
  • B WECAM series camera ×1
  • C Power adapter: input AC 100–240 V 50/60 Hz; output DC 12 V 1 A (GS12U12-P1I / GS12E12-P1I)
  • D USB mouse ×1
  • E HDMI 2.0 cable ×1
  • F High-speed USB 2.0 A↔A gold-plated data cable (2.0 m)
  • G Driver and application disc (Ø12 cm)

Optional Accessories

  • H SD card (≥16 GB, Class 10)
  • I Adjustable eyepiece adapters 108001/AMA037, 108002/AMA050, 108003/AMA075
  • J Fixed eyepiece adapters 108005/FMA037, 108006/FMA050, 108007/FMA075
  • K 30 mm eyepiece conversion ring 108015
  • L 30.5 mm eyepiece conversion ring 108016
  • M Micrometer 106011/TS-M1, 106012/TS-M2, 106013/TS-M7
  • N USB flash drive (backup media)
  • O USB Wi-Fi adapter (required for Wi-Fi/AP mode)

WECAM Wi-Fi + Ethernet Microscope Camera — Product Overview

Tupu Optoelectronics WECAM series combines Wi-Fi and Ethernet transmission to deliver flexible microscope imaging without a computer. It is purpose-built for interactive teaching, laboratory research, and industrial inspection workflows that need multi-terminal sharing.

Equipped with a Sony Exmor back-illuminated CMOS sensor, WECAM streams high-resolution HDMI, Wi-Fi, USB 3.0, and LAN video, supports local storage, and integrates the XCamView intelligent control suite.

Technical Highlights

  • Wi-Fi + Ethernet transmission: Dual-mode networking enables AP/STA Wi-Fi sharing (USB Wi-Fi adapter required) and Gigabit Ethernet streaming.
  • Standalone HDMI preview: HDMI 2.0 output connects directly to displays, projectors, or capture devices.
  • Local storage support: Save images and videos to SD cards or USB flash drives with on-camera playback.
  • Cross-platform software ecosystem: Compatible with ToupView and ToupLite for video reception, measurement, and analysis, plus convenient mobile control via iOS/Android apps.
  • Multi-terminal teaching collaboration: Build a microscope teaching network for shared, real-time viewing across multiple devices—ideal for lab classrooms and remote courses.
  • Robust, adaptable design: The C-mount fits a wide range of microscope systems while the hardware platform ensures stable operation for long-term research and teaching use.
